What is the difference between Network Administrator vs Network Engineer?

AspectNetwork AdministratorNetwork Engineer
CertificationsCompTIA Network+, Cisco CCNACompTIA Network+, Cisco CCNA, Cisco CCNP
Work EnvironmentMaintains and supports existing networksDesigns and implements new network solutions
ResponsibilitiesNetwork troubleshooting, maintenance, user supportNetwork design, architecture, and deployment
Industry UsageCommonly employed in SMBs and IT support rolesOften found in large enterprises and infrastructure projects

While both roles involve network-related tasks, Network Administrators focus on maintaining and supporting existing networks, whereas Network Engineers are responsible for designing and building new network solutions. The certifications and work environments overlap but differ in scope and complexity.

What is a network administrator?

A Network Administrator oversees hardware and software used to run an organization’s data network. As a Network Administrator, your responsibilities and duties include managing the company’s data systems, monitoring and troubleshooting the system for issues, and providing technical support for users. Network Administrators usually serve on a team of information technology professionals. They coordinate with various departments to determine the current and future technology needs of the company. Their primary goal is to ensure that the system is meeting, and will continue to meet, the demands of the business.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a network administrator,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Network Administrator, you need a solid understanding of networking protocols, hardware, and security principles, typically supported by a degree in information technology or computer science. Familiarity with tools like Cisco IOS, network monitoring systems, and certifications such as CompTIA Network+ or Cisco CCNA are highly valued. Strong problem-solving skills, attention to detail, and effective communication help you manage issues and coordinate with users or IT teams. These skills are crucial for maintaining secure, efficient network operations and minimizing downtime in any organization.

What does a network administrator do?

A Network Administrator is responsible for managing, maintaining, and troubleshooting an organization's computer networks. This includes installing and configuring network hardware and software, monitoring network performance, ensuring network security, and providing technical support to users. Network Administrators also perform routine backups, update system documentation, and implement network upgrades or expansions as needed. Their goal is to ensure reliable and secure network operations for all users within the organization.

What are some common challenges a network administrator faces when managing a growing company's IT infrastructure?

As a company expands, Network Administrators often encounter challenges such as scaling the network to accommodate more users, ensuring consistent security across a larger footprint, and minimizing downtime during upgrades or migrations. Balancing the need for robust cybersecurity with user accessibility can be complex, especially when implementing new technologies or remote work solutions. Staying current with evolving networking tools and best practices is essential to proactively address these challenges and support organizational growth.
